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Dolibarr

  • The core is deliberately shallow, so a serious requirement such as advanced manufacturing, EDI or a specific payment gateway usually means buying a DoliStore module from a third-party author, and the quality and maintenance of those modules varies widely.
  • Accounting was designed around French practice, and the chart of accounts, VAT model and fiscal exports need real work to satisfy accountants in the United States, the UK or Australia.
  • The interface is functional rather than designed and shows its age against Odoo, which makes internal adoption harder when staff are comparing it to consumer-grade software.
  • Upgrades between major versions can break paid third-party modules, because module authors update on their own schedules and there is no guarantee your combination will work on version 24 the day it ships.
  • Support is community forums unless you buy a partner contract, and the documentation is a wiki of uneven quality with substantial parts written in French, so English-only teams hit dead ends.

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Dolibarr: Is Dolibarr genuinely free?

Yes. The full application is GPL with no user limit and no paid edition of the core. You pay only for hosting, optional DoliStore modules and optional partner support.

Dolibarr: Can it run on shared hosting?

Yes, that is its main practical advantage. It needs only PHP and MySQL or MariaDB, so an ordinary cPanel account is enough.

Dolibarr: How does it compare to Odoo?

Odoo is deeper and better presented but its useful modules are in the paid Enterprise edition and it needs a proper deployment. Dolibarr is thinner but free end to end and far easier to host.

Dolibarr: Does it handle UK or US accounting?

Not comfortably out of the box. The accounting module reflects French conventions and needs configuration and often a local module to satisfy an accountant elsewhere.
